LOB 455X is a 1981 Austin Morris Mini City in Red with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.
Across all 1981 Austin Morris Mini City models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.1% with a typical mileage of 55,006 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Austin Morris Mini City fails its MOT is subframe m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 547 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LOB 455X,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Austin Morris Mini City typically stays on UK roads for around 47 years. At 45 years old, this Austin Morris Mini City is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
